Procter & Gamble introduced its Duncan Hines ready-to-spread frosting in a small geographic area. When General Foods became aware of the product, it rushed to market its own Betty Crocker ready-to-spread frosting, which eclipsed the Duncan Hines product introduction. General Foods was able to enter the ________ stage of the new-product development process before Procter & Gamble could.

Supplier Performance Index

Supplier Performance Index is a quantitative score that measures and evaluates the performance of a supplier based on criteria like quality, delivery, and service.

Purchase Price

The amount paid to acquire a good or service.

Supplier Costs

Expenses incurred for goods or services purchased from vendors, including the cost of materials, as well as any delivery or handling charges.

Economic Order Quantity

The optimal quantity of inventory to order that minimizes total inventory costs, including holding and ordering costs.
